The flames in the fireplace are dancing in time
To the hearts of our children at play,
And fragrance of turkey is drifting about
Like the tunes they are singing today.
The pies in the oven are light golden brown
And the pudding is still steaming hot,
The table is laden with delicacies
Brightly set and nothing forgot.
The chores are completed, the family arrives;
Now good friends and relations as well,
And the walls reecho fond greetings around
And nice things we've been saving to tell.
Our dinner is served, and each plate quickly heaped
With the best things that a wife can prepare.
Now voices are hushed and our heads slowly bow
While we pause for a moment of prayer.
As once did the Pilgrims on old Plymouth Rock,
We pilgrims of earth now thank Thee, God,
For all Thy goodness and blessings and love,
For abundance we reap from the sod.
Please grant us perception of beauty and worth.
Help us look at the things which we see,
That learning the value of life and its gifts
We'll be evermore grateful to Thee.
